<B>James II Half-Guinea 1688,</B></I> S-3404. The "B" in IACOBVS appears to be a recut "R." Laureate bust, the only style of portrait used. Reverse styled after the design of the preceding coinage--that of James's older brother (Charles II), but lacking the central interlocked C's. Final year of this 3-year reign, and historically interesting as the Glorious Revolution (in which Parliament declared James II no longer king) commenced in November of this year. Catalogues in the 2007 Spink guide book for $3,750 (about $7,500) in EF grade, with no value given for a higher grade such as we have here, reflecting its rarity. MS63 NGC. Formerly PCGS-graded MS63 and a Terner Registry coin (Terner I sale, Goldbergs, May 2003, Lot 130). Both major grading services agreed, then, that here is a Choice Uncirculated specimen, although it is somewhat softly struck in the centers as is typical of these issues, with a streak of tin-flecks (impurities in the gold alloy) horizontally across the king's cheek. Bright satiny luster, lovely clean surfaces, and original, old-time gold toning are all hallmarks of Terner coins, present on this specimen.
